Interior problems like burst pipes as well as overflows can result in emergency situation flooding. Maintain on reviewing to locate out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Valve

Pipelines can break due to cold temps, high pressure, clog, hot water heater concerns, and also other elements. No matter the cause, you should act quickly to ensure porous residence products, appliances, and also home furnishings do not soak up the water, leading to damage. Shut off the main valve before you do any cleaning to make certain water quits pouring in. Eliminating the water resource is basic, and it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the burst pipe, call for emergency pipes services to repair it right away.

2. Turn off the Breaker

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can trigger inj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off until exc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Important Wet Times

When it involves conserving your home furnishings and appliances, time is of the essence. You have to relocate whatever whet belongings you can from the afflicted area to a completely dry area. This deters further damages because the longer they soak in water, the a lot more extensive the problem.

4. File the Degree of Damages

Make note of all the damages inflicted by the burst pipe. You can jot down notes, take pictures, and gather videos. This is a excellent means to supply evidence to collect claims on your home insurance policy protection. With paperwork, you can additionally obtain a clear photo of the degree of the damage.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You should get rid of excess water as soon as feasible. Need to there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for removal. When minimal water is left, you can saturate up the rest with old tee sh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Area

You can additionally set up electric fans as well as placed them in the strongest setup. A dehumidifier likewise functions in taking out dampness to avoid mildew and also mold and mildews.

7. Deal with Professionals

When you experience extensive water damage because of emergency situation flooding from a burst pipeline, you can work with a remediation expert to reconstruct and remodel your residence. Above all, don't fail to remember to call a credible plumbing professional to deal with the ruptured pipeline and examine the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will certainly be made useless.

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you reside in a storm-prone location, you ought to be utilized by now on what to do, where to go and what to have to be prepared for bad weather. However, if you're not used to obtaining pounded by high winds as well as tough rainfall, you most likely do not have an concept how ideal to encounter a tornado circumstance.

For starters, tornados do not simply come without a caution. Weather stations check the environment everyday. If a storm is feasible, they will provide 2 sorts of warnings:

Storm watch-- is provided when there is a possible tornado in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, gloomy skies, an abnormally gusty day and also some rainfall. The storm may or may not come, but this is the moment to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for news as well as upd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ed towards your location. Attempt to stay indoors as high as possible. Or if citizens are encouraged to evacuate to a much safer location, go as early as you can. Don't wait till the last minute to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be swamped and also website traffic is bad. You don't want to be captured in your automobile in bad climate.

Snowstorm-- typically happens in wintertime and also means hefty snow, solid winds and wind cool. When a warning is provided, stay clear of traveling as long as feasible as well as stay indoors. There is no usage revealing yourself outdoors where you could obtain trapped in traffic or in locations where you will certainly be hard to reach or even worse, find.

Points don't always go negative during storms, yet weather is uncertain and anything can take place. To help you prepare for a tornado emergency situation, here are a couple of tips:

Dress up.
Wear enough clothing to maintain on your own warm. Heat may not be offered in your residence so obtain added layers and also coverings to keep your body temperature complet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and also boots prepared also.

Have food ready.
Emergency stipulations are a have to during storm emergency situations. Ensure you stock on no-cook food, canned food, some candy as well as various other non-perishable things. And also don't fail to remember can openers, scissors or tools. If the tornado obtains regrettable and the streets are swamped, you will certainly have a difficulty going out to the grocery shops. Shops could be closed.

Keep containers of water helpful. Clean water may be difficult ahead by during actually poor problems and the most awful thing you can do is suffer from d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at least one gallon for each person each day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ill the bathtub.
You'll need more water for cleaning and pur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have little kids in the house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and keeping youngsters far from the restroom unless needed.

Emergency package
Have a clinical or first kit prepared and also ensure it's freshly-stocked. It ought to consist of disinfectants, gauzes, cotton rounds, Q-tips, medicated plasters and necessary medications. It's likewise a good concept to have another kit in your cars and truck.

If any person in your household is under unique medicine, ensure you have enough products to last until after the tornado is over as well as drug shops are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power failures throughout tornado emergencies. You will not have any kind of electrical power, so supply on candles,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have additional fresh batteries and also suits in case you go out.

If you can't activ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your location. Media will certainly check the storm as well as will maintain you updated.

You may require hot water during the duration when power is not yet available, so keep a small storage tank of gas around just in case. Your outside gas grill will certainly do well.

Get an alternate shelter.
Make certain you have adequate gas in your storage tank in case you need to get out of the residence and action some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have far better chances of being risk-free as well as dry.
